Eryngium is a natural thistle, also known as Sea Holly, air dried for flower arranging and flower crowns. Each bunch consists of 5 or more branched stems, just under 60cm long. Each small natural thistle flower is approximately 1 to 3 cm long. Natural variability means that the dried flower heads and stems can vary from a rich metallic blue through paler shades to silver, green and brown. Eryngium is popular in floristry for weddings or to add an architectural element to a bouquet or home decor. Being part of the thistle family, eryngiums are popular for Scottish themed events.
